    This immaculate dramatic Penthouse level two bedroom, two full-bath condominium with a stunning loft/den, exclusive private rooftop deck, and dedicated reserved surface parking is all yours in a fantastic location. Concealed behind a historic facade, this 14 unit condominium was built in 2005 and this top floor unit is a rare find in the neighborhood at this price point. The exceptional duplex residence boasts soaring 16+' cathedral ceilings, recessed lighting throughout, and a flood of natural light streaming through expansive windows. The open, airy layout features a chef's kitchen with granite counters, stainless steel appliances, and plenty of cabinet space. It is adjacent to an inviting living room featuring a large gas fireplace with mantel, and an elegant dining area with a Romeo and Juliet front balcony. The spacious primary bedroom with a large closet has an en-suite limestone tile shower and its own balcony overlooking the quiet community courtyard. The second bedroom has a spacious closet and is served by a hall full bath with shower next to a convenient washer and dryer. Ascend to the loft, a versatile space that can effortlessly transform into a media haven or a productive home office. This enchanting loft opens onto a sunny private rooftop deck. With city views of the Old Post Office Tower and Washington Monument, enjoy next year's the 4th of July fireworks in the privacy of your own intimate oasis. Savor tranquil moments or host delightful al fresco gatherings.
